The Mesa - Victorian Era Coral Cameo 10k Gold Brooch c.1800s Antique

This antique Victorian brooch, dating to the mid-1800s, showcases remarkable goldwork surrounding a hand-carved coral cameo of a classical figure. Crafted in 10k yellow gold, the piece features elaborate chased and engraved detailing with textured floral accents, rope-twist borders, and ornate wire scrolls—each element demonstrating the extraordinary artistry characteristic of early Victorian jewelry. Delicate articulated drops add graceful movement, enhancing the brooch’s sculptural presence and making it a true testament to fine 19th-century craftsmanship

Metals: tested 10k (tests higher then 10k gold in places depending on what part of the piece is tested), pin was added at a later time and is not gold

Markings:  unmarked (gold items crafted pre 1906 hallmarking legislation did not typically carry hallmarks)

Gemstones: coral cameo carving, some dings to the back of the coral
